Welcome to Euro Steel

“Our core business is the stocking, processing and distribution of corrosion resistant metals such as stainless steel, duplex stainless grades, other non-standard special and hard wearing steels and aluminium - in most profiles. We specialize in stocking the full range of stainless steel and aluminium flat and long products and distribute an extensive range of standard and customized extruded aluminium products including  aluminium architectural systems and hardware. We also offer customers related products such as Chrome-Moly, Hardox, Hastelloy , electro galvanized sheet (Zintex) and Chromadek".

  • ‘The fierce urgency of now’
    What can government do to improve the outlook for growth and job creation in light of some serious external and domestic economic headwinds? Standard Bank’s chief economist Goolam Ballim has provided one quite helpful answer to this question: raise public sector investment to levels where South Africa can once again sustain a minimum yearly investment rate of 25% of gross domestic product (GDP), which will, in turn, help raise overall growth levels.
  • New rules
    It is interesting to note that Consulting Engineers South Africa (Cesa) has made an application to the Department of Trade and Industry (DTI) for engineering consulting services to be given ‘designated’ status under government’s preferential procurement rules. Under newly introduced regulations, the DTI has the authority to stipulate that government departments, agencies and SoCs procure designated products and services from local manufacturers, or providers.
  • Good news, but . . .
    Amid the prevailing economic gloom and doom, it came as welcome relief to learn that South Africa’s foreign direct investment (FDI) inflows rose 269% in 2011 – climbing to $4.5-billion last year from a revised 2010 figure of $1.2-billion. The South African recovery was underpinned by the contested $2.4-billion purchase of a majority interest in JSE-listed Massmart by retail giant Wal-Mart, of the US.
